Oracle数据库中查询元数据的实践(oracle查询元数据)
2023-06-13 09:18:59 时间
Oracle 数据库中查询元数据的实践
Oracle 数据库是用于存储和管理各种信息的关系型数据库管理系统。查询元数据是在 Oracle 数据库中进行数据表信息查询的一种技巧,该策略在应用程序中常被用来查询数据表的结构、索引信息以及列名称等元数据。
在 Oracle 数据库中,可以利用一组数据字典视图来查询、访问元数据,如 USER_TABLES 来查询用户下的所有表名, USER_TAB_COLUMNS 来查询特定表的列名等。Oracle 还提供了各种丰富的功能来查询和访问元数据,例如 DBMS_METADATA 包、DBMS_DESCRIBE 包等。
下面是一个示例,在 Oracle 中实现查询指定表中的所有列名等元数据:
SQL
SELECT c.column_name, c.data_type, c.data_length, c.data_precision, c.data_scale, c.nullable
FROM user_tab_columns c
WHERE c.table_name = MY_TABLE
上面的查询,将检索名为 MY_TABLE 的表的所有列的元数据,包括列名、数据类型、数据长度、精度、刻度、可为 null 等信息。
许多现代应用程序使用查询元数据来检测现存表的结构,以及更新表结构,这在数据仓库应用程序或多用户应用程序中特别有用。Oracle 数据库中查询元数据的 API 或视图,开发者可以更好地控制各种查询操作,提升技术水平。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 Oracle数据库中查询元数据的实践(oracle查询元数据)
相关文章
- 管理Oracle数据库,让你更有效率(oracle数据库信息)
- 移动Oracle表空间:步骤与操作详解(oracle表空间移动)
- Oracle数据库与其他类型数据库比较分析(oracle其他数据库)
- 数据库VS连接Oracle数据库:轻松实现连接(vs连接oracle)
- Oracle数据库的三大范式(oracle三大范式)
- 掌握Oracle触发器类型的全部知识(oracle触发器类型)
- Oracle数据库中使用触发器的类型简介(oracle触发器类型)
- Oracle数据库中的触发器类型研究(oracle触发器类型)
- 开启Oracle数据库之旅:物理结构学习指南(oracle物理结构)
- 精简Oracle客户端——轻松连接数据库(oracle客户端精简版)
- 高效使用Oracle客户端,简单上手!(精简版oracle客户端)
- 优化Oracle数据库SQL优化实践指南(oracle执行sql)
- 使用yum工具轻松安装Oracle数据库(yum安装oracle)
- 用C语言连接远程Oracle数据库(c 连接远程oracle)
- MySQL与Oracle比较两大数据库的特点(myaql和oracle)
- 品评跨越MV Oracle的完美旋律(mv oracle)
- Oracle主从级联删除实现最佳数据一致性(oracle主从级联删除)
- Oracle极具竞争优势的IT数据库选择(oracle为什么受欢迎)
- Oracle介绍学习专业视频详解(oracle介绍视频)
- Oracle位数补足实现字符串精准处理(oracle位数补足)
- Oracle数据库优化视图查询实践(oracle优化视图查询)
- 探索Oracle数据库中的排序策略(oracle中的排序方式)
- 子句利用Oracle中的When子句处理条件性逻辑(oracle中的when)
- 保存在Oracle中存储查询结果的简单方法(oracle中将查询结果)
- Oracle两表求差精准获取有差异数据(oracle 两表求差)
- Oracle数据库探索上溯节点之旅(oracle上溯节点)
- 显示Oracle中支持一行数据多行显示的分割技术(oracle一行数据多行)